Do you have any evidence that after an OPEN ... BINARY ACCESS READ pointer is not at the beginning of the file?
Because file channel is a new one, even if file is already open in the same process, it should create a new file structure setting pointer to the beginning of the file.
I'm not aware of problems on that side but if you have good reason a will change.
Thanks
Eros
Bookmarks